Customer ServiceBefore deciding on the best way to use solar electricity at home, assess the potential solar energy that can be produced at your address. Because PV technologies use both direct and scattered sunlight to create electricity, the solar resource across the United States is ample for home solar electric systems.
One of the most efficient ways for communities to go solar is through a Solarize program. Solarize programs allow a locally organized group of homeowners and businesses to pool their purchasing power to competitively select an installer and negotiate reduced rates.

With the required system capacity determined, divide it by the capacity of each panel. For instance, if your calculated system capacity is 5kW and each panel has a capacity of 500W, you would need 10 panels.
